Olivia Jade has made her return to social media for the first time since her parents, Lori Loughlin and Mossimo Giannulli, pleaded guilty in the college admissions scandal.
The two originally claimed their innocence but changed their plea on May 22.
Jade, an influencer who has been touch and go since the admissions scandal first broke last March, had two posts on Monday.
One was an ad for Kim Kardashian’s SKIMS and the other a post for Memorial Day.

Kim Kardashian has broken her silence in the wake of George Floyd‘s death. The 39-year-old Keeping Up with the Kardashians star took to Instagram on May 30 to express how “angry” and “exhausted” she was after a video surfaced of the unarmed black man being pinned to the ground by fired police officer Derek Chauvin. “For years, with every horrific murder of an innocent black man, woman, or child, I have always tried to find the right words to express my condolences and outrage,” she began.

New streaming service Quibi released the first trailer for Kirby Jenner on May 24, a satirical offshoot of Keeping Up With The Kardashians — and it’s hilarious. The spin-off of E!‘s flagship show stars Kirby, who refers to himself as Kendall Jenner‘s “fraternal twin brother”, and will feature eight-episodes.
It’s the biggest “secret” in reality TV’s royal family since Caitlyn Jenner.
